The History of the West End Neighborhood in Atlanta, GA
West End is one of Atlanta’s oldest neighborhoods, with roots that predate the founding of Atlanta itself. The community developed around the historic Whitehall Tavern and later grew into a popular residential area after Atlanta’s first municipal streetcar line reached West End in 1871.

What Does It Cost to Hire a Personal Injury Lawyer in Fulton County?
Most personal injury lawyers in Fulton County work on a contingency fee basis. This means you typically do not pay upfront attorney’s fees, and the lawyer receives an agreed-upon percentage of the compensation recovered in your case.
If there is no recovery, you generally do not owe attorney’s fees. During a free consultation, you can ask about the fee agreement and any potential case-related costs before deciding whether to hire an attorney.
Statute of Limitations in Georgia Personal Injury Cases
Georgia generally gives injured people two years to file a personal injury lawsuit. The deadline typically begins when the cause of action accrues, which in many accident cases is the date of the injury.
Certain circumstances can affect the filing deadline, so it is important not to assume that you have the full two years in every case. Speaking with a personal injury lawyer as soon as possible can help you determine the deadline that applies and preserve your right to pursue compensation.
